Minimal frameless shower spaces simple to create with Bellagio
Enabling a bespoke, contemporary showering space to be created in virtually any situation, Bellagio is a new adjustable shower door hinge with cover plates from CRL that taps into the latest trends in bathroom design too. With in-built seals for a seamless, high-performance finish, Bellagio, made from solid brass, features a modern square design and is suitable for use with 8 and 10 mm tempered safety glass. Ideal for creating a wetroom-inspired, spa-like shower area and tapping into the trend for frameless, minimal showering, the Bellagio square cornered hinge has a compact design and minimalist look due to the small gaps and cover plates, which are simple to fix and to remove. Combining design, functionality and quality, the zero position of the hinge is adjustable with a capacity of 50kg, when using 2 hinges, and a maximum door width of 1 metre. This makes it straightforward to create a showering area from an existing space, such as in the corner of a bedroom, in loft extensions or even understairs. Available in three finishes of Chrome, Matte Black and Brushed Nickel, Bellagio can be chosen with a range of matching clamps, support bars and other CRL shower hardware.

SFA Group – Saniflo UK’s parent company – has been awarded a Bronze Medal for Corporate Social Responsibility from EcoVadis, one of the world’s most trusted providers of business sustainability ratings. This result places the SFA Group among the top 50% of companies assessed by EcoVadis. Saniflo UK Head of Marketing and
Product Management, Ann Boardman, says: “At Sanifo UK we uphold the same high standards set by our parent company, SFA Group in France. We pride ourselves on our ongoing commitment to being the best we can be in all ways, always. This Bronze medal is well deserved.”
